iscsi_tcp: Use ahash

This patch replaces uses of the long obsolete hash interface with
ahash.

Signed-off-by: Herbert Xu <herbert@gondor.apana.org.au>
Reviewed-by: Mike Christie <michaelc@cs.wisc.edu>
